Can I use spaghetti for Chinese noodles?

Yes, spaghetti may be used in place of chow mein noodles if you boil it with a tiny bit of baking soda before serving. The baking soda changes the pH level of the spaghetti, giving it a texture and flavor that is comparable to that of chow mein noodle soup. Afterwards, you can use them in any recipe that asks for chow mein noodles.

What’s the difference between chow mein and lo mein?

In English, chow mein refers to fried noodles, whereas lo mein refers to noodles that have been tossed or stirred. Because both chow mein and lo mein are variants on noodles, the primary distinction between the two meals is the method through which the noodles are made.

What kind of noodles are in spaghetti?

Spaghetti.Characteristics: In the United States, this long, round strand of pasta is the most common variety of pasta available.A variety of spaghetti shapes are available, including spaghettini (thinner), spaghettoni (thicker), bucatini (thicker and straw-like, with a hollow center), capellini (extremely thin), and angel’s hair.Spaghetti is an Italian word that literally translates as ″small thread″ (thinnest).

Are egg noodles and spaghetti the same thing?

Both egg noodles and pasta are unleavened dough items, and both are made from eggs. Here are a few examples of the distinctions: Ingredients: The most significant distinction between egg noodles and pasta is that the former must include eggs while the latter does not. While eggs are used in many handmade pasta recipes, most dry pasta from the store does not include them.
